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6294 84722 5954392 841643 9133990165
32750390248 5382914721 378442671
32750390248 5382914721 378442671
42501 748635 202
All about undefined
Interested in learning more?
32750390248 5382914721 378442671
42501 748635 202
See more
14255109699 36 65459
336442301 81 69354562630
See more
48205 5502091
86635 36849806288 220662900 1832268
See more